Understanding GPS Accuracy in Wearable Devices
GPS accuracy in wearable devices depends on several factors, including the quality of the GPS chipset, the number of satellites in view, environmental conditions, and how the device processes signals. High-end watches often have multi-GNSS support, combining signals from various satellite systems like GPS, GLONASS, and Galileo to improve accuracy.

Real-World Performance of the Polar Ignite 3
In practical trail running scenarios, the Polar Ignite 3 tends to have a positional accuracy within 5-10 meters under good conditions. Runners have reported that the device accurately tracks their routes and distances in open terrain. However, in dense forests or mountainous regions, some deviations are common, and the recorded distance may be slightly underestimated or overestimated.
Comparison with Other Devices
Compared to high-end GPS watches like Garmin Fenix or Suunto, the Polar Ignite 3 offers slightly less precise tracking, especially in challenging environments. However, for casual trail runners and those not requiring pinpoint accuracy, it performs admirably and provides reliable data for training and progress tracking.
